About the Good Sports Awards

The Good Sports Awards happen every year. They celebrate the star Good Sports clubs who are community leaders, helping to disrupt the link between alcohol and sport, reducing risky drinking and children’s exposure to alcohol.

Winners will be promoted by Good Sports through our social media, website, and national and local media, and receive a cash prize that will be used to benefit their club. A total of $13,500 in prizes is up for grabs.

There are seven award categories:

  • Club of the Year
  • Club Volunteer of the Year
  • Safe Transport Award
  • Community Club Award
  • Mental Health Excellence Award
  • Junior Club of the Year
  • New Club of the Year.

Key dates

  • Nominations are open now
  • Nominations close midnight, November 10
  • Awards ceremony will be held in early 2026 at Parliament House, Canberra.
